Unveiling the Power and Potential of Continuously Tunable Laser Sources

Continuously tunable laser sources have emerged as cornerstone technologies across a spectrum of sectors, offering unparalleled wavelength agility and precision. As applications extend from advanced communications to biomedical imaging and defense systems, these lasers enable rapid adaptation to evolving requirements without requiring multiple discrete devices. Their inherent versatility empowers researchers, manufacturers, and system integrators to optimize performance in real time, driving both innovation and cost efficiency.

Over the past decade, advances in photonic integration, novel tuning mechanisms, and refined control electronics have elevated system reliability while expanding accessible wavelength ranges. This convergence of material science, microelectromechanical systems, and digital control architectures has accelerated the adoption of tunable lasers in mission-critical environments. Consequently, stakeholders now face a multifaceted landscape where technological sophistication, regulatory shifts, and supply chain resilience determine competitive positioning.

Pivotal Innovations Reshaping the Tunable Laser Domain

The continuously tunable laser sector is undergoing a period of transformative innovation driven by breakthroughs in tuning mechanisms and integrated photonics. Grating-based architectures now coexist with microelectromechanical systems and thermal tuning techniques, offering unprecedented wavelength control across broad spectral spans. At the same time, electro-optic and acousto-optic solutions deliver rapid modulation rates essential for advanced metrology and sensing applications.

Concurrently, the rise of photonic integrated circuits has facilitated compact, energy-efficient platforms that seamlessly incorporate tunable elements alongside amplifiers and filters. This trend has unlocked new avenues in data center networking and fiber-optic communications by reducing footprint and power consumption without compromising performance. Meanwhile, directed energy and countermeasure systems within defense and aerospace sectors have capitalized on the enhanced beam control afforded by modern tunable lasers, bolstering mission effectiveness.

Emerging applications in optical coherence tomography and spectroscopic metrology are further broadening the scope, as tunable lasers enable high-resolution imaging and precise chemical analysis. When combined with advanced digital signal processing and machine learning algorithms, these sources can adaptively optimize output characteristics, marking a paradigm shift in how lasers integrate into complex system architectures. Collectively, these innovations are redefining the landscape and setting new benchmarks for versatility, scalability, and cost efficiency.

Assessing the Ripple Effects of US Tariffs on the Tunable Laser Market

In 2025, newly imposed United States tariffs on certain photonic components and laser source imports have introduced a significant layer of complexity to supply chains. Manufacturers reliant on overseas subassemblies now face elevated input costs, compelling procurement teams to reassess sourcing strategies. As duties increase the landed cost of critical parts, companies have accelerated efforts to diversify suppliers and evaluate nearshoring options to cushion the financial impact.

These trade measures have had a cascading effect on research and development budgets. To maintain competitive pricing, some organizations have streamlined product portfolios, prioritizing high-margin configurations while postponing investments in niche tuning mechanisms. Meanwhile, forward-looking firms are leveraging tariff-induced cost pressures as an impetus to bolster domestic production capabilities, forging partnerships with local fabricators and exploring government incentives designed to onshore advanced manufacturing.

From a strategic standpoint, the tariffs have also influenced pricing models and contract negotiations. System integrators are incorporating contingency clauses to address potential tariff escalations, and stakeholders are increasingly transparent about cost pass-through practices. This heightened focus on fiscal resilience is reshaping collaboration across the value chain, fostering a new era of agility in cost management and supply network design.

Revealing Core Market Segments Driving Laser Adoption

The market’s trajectory is profoundly influenced by application-driven demand patterns. In defense and aerospace, countermeasure systems, directed energy platforms, and precision range-finding units require laser sources that deliver rapid tuning across specific spectral windows. Healthcare and medical imaging applications-especially biomedical imaging, laser surgery, and optical coherence tomography-prioritize sources with minimal noise and stable output to ensure patient safety and diagnostic accuracy.

Industrial inspection, material processing, and sensing apparatus equally benefit from tunable sources that can switch wavelengths on the fly to detect material defects, process coatings, or perform non-contact measurements with high fidelity. Scientific research initiatives in lidar, metrology, and spectroscopy push the envelope further, demanding lasers that span from visible to shortwave infrared regimes while offering nanometer-level precision. Meanwhile, telecom applications in data center networking, fiber-optic communications, and optical networking equipment hinge on finely tuned sources capable of supporting dense wavelength division multiplexing at scale.

Regarding product typologies, external cavity lasers with Littman Metcalf or Littrow configurations remain workhorses for laboratory settings, while tunable fiber lasers-whether Raman-based or rare earth-doped-address higher-power demands in industrial environments. Compact tunable laser diodes and vertical cavity surface-emitting lasers have gained traction in cost-sensitive applications where form factor and electrical efficiency matter most.

Tuning mechanisms such as acousto-optic, electro-optic, grating-based, MEMS-driven, and thermal approaches each offer unique trade-offs across speed, tuning range, and system footprint. Wavelength coverage segments into C, L, and S bands, aligning with telecom and sensing requirements, whereas component-level differentiation highlights the role of fiber Bragg gratings, specialized laser diodes, MEMS mirrors, optical filters, and temperature controllers in tailoring performance to end-use demands.

Geographic Dynamics Shaping Global Laser Demand

In the Americas, market growth is propelled by robust defense spending and an expansive telecommunications infrastructure undergoing constant upgrades. Collaboration between military prime contractors and laser developers fosters bespoke countermeasure and directed energy solutions, while commercial research institutions invest heavily in biomedical and spectroscopic programs. Incentive schemes promoting domestic manufacturing have further stimulated capital inflows into photonics facilities.

Europe, the Middle East, and Africa exhibit a distinct blend of academic excellence and industrial modernization. Regulatory support for research in optical coherence tomography and metrology has elevated demand for high-precision tunable lasers. Concurrently, oil and gas sectors in the Middle East and North Africa are integrating spectroscopic sensing systems to monitor process streams, leveraging thermally tunable and MEMS-based sources for real-time analysis.

Asia-Pacific stands out for its manufacturing prowess and rapidly expanding fiber-optic networks. High-growth economies are investing in data center expansion, driving demand for C and L band tunable sources optimized for dense wavelength division multiplexing. Simultaneously, regional research consortia are piloting lidar and remote sensing projects, with a focus on cost-effective tunable solutions that can meet stringent volume and performance criteria.
